The Importance of Coordination in Home Healthcare


Home healthcare involves various stakeholders, including patients, family members, nurses, and doctors. Each plays a crucial role in ensuring that patients receive the best care possible. However, without proper coordination, this process can become chaotic.


Effective coordination leads to:


  • Improved patient outcomes: When everyone is on the same page, patients receive timely and appropriate care.


  • Reduced hospital readmissions: Proper follow-up and communication can prevent complications that lead to hospital visits.


  • Enhanced patient satisfaction: Patients feel more secure when they know their care team is working together.


By enhancing coordination, CareConnect aims to address these challenges and improve the overall home healthcare experience.


Features of the CareConnect Prototype


CareConnect is packed with features designed to facilitate communication and coordination. Here are some of the key functionalities:


1. Centralized Communication Hub


CareConnect serves as a centralized platform for all communication. Patients, caregivers, and healthcare providers can share updates, ask questions, and provide feedback in real time. This reduces the chances of miscommunication and ensures everyone is informed.


2. Task Management Tools


The prototype includes task management tools that help caregivers keep track of their responsibilities. They can set reminders for medication, appointments, and other essential tasks. This feature ensures that nothing falls through the cracks.


3. Health Monitoring Integration


CareConnect can integrate with various health monitoring devices. This allows healthcare providers to track patients' vital signs and health metrics remotely. Real-time data can help in making informed decisions about patient care.


4. Educational Resources


The platform offers educational resources for patients and caregivers. These resources can include articles, videos, and tutorials on managing specific health conditions. Empowering patients with knowledge can lead to better self-management.


5. Feedback Mechanism


CareConnect includes a feedback mechanism that allows patients and caregivers to share their experiences. This feedback can be invaluable for healthcare providers looking to improve their services.

Challenges and Considerations


While CareConnect offers many benefits, there are challenges to consider.


1. Technology Adoption


Not all patients and caregivers may be comfortable using technology. Training and support will be essential to ensure everyone can use the platform effectively.


2. Data Privacy


With the integration of health monitoring devices, data privacy is a significant concern. CareConnect must ensure that patient data is secure and compliant with regulations.


3. Integration with Existing Systems


CareConnect needs to integrate seamlessly with existing healthcare systems. This can be a complex process, requiring collaboration with various stakeholders.
